Understanding the Shadow Fleet Dilemma

The phrase “shadow fleet” describes a secretive network of unregistered or unregulated ships that operate outside the reach of international maritime laws. These vessels are often involved in illicit activities like smuggling, human trafficking, and illegal fishing. For years, governments and maritime organizations have struggled to track and monitor these ships, resulting in significant gaps in maritime security and governance.

The Emergence of Agentic AI

Agentic AI, a branch of artificial intelligence that can operate independently and make decisions based on data analysis, is being seen as a potential game-changer for addressing the shadow fleet issue. Unlike traditional AI systems that depend heavily on human input, agentic AI can sift through massive amounts of data in real-time, spot patterns, and make decisions on its own.

Notable Features of Agentic AI

  1. Independent Decision-Making: Agentic AI can analyze information and make choices without needing human oversight, enabling swift responses to emerging threats.
  2. Data Integration: It can gather data from multiple sources, including satellite images, AIS (Automatic Identification System) signals, and historical shipping records.
  3. Predictive Analytics: By examining trends and behaviors, agentic AI can foresee potential illegal activities and flag vessels that might belong to the shadow fleet.

The Impact of Agentic AI

Integrating agentic AI into maritime surveillance could have far-reaching implications:
Improved Security: Enhanced detection capabilities allow nations to better safeguard their waters against illegal activities.
Efficient Resource Allocation: Authorities can use AI analytics to prioritize high-risk areas, optimizing resource deployment.
International Collaboration: Shared AI systems can promote cooperation among countries, leading to a more coordinated approach to maritime security.

Challenges to Overcome

Despite its promise, the use of agentic AI in maritime contexts comes with several challenges:
Data Privacy Issues: The gathering and analysis of maritime data could raise privacy concerns, especially for commercial shipping.
Technological Constraints: The accuracy of AI predictions relies heavily on the quality and volume of available data.
Regulatory Challenges: Existing international maritime laws may need to adapt to accommodate AI in monitoring and enforcement.
